    • A virtual reality presentation apparatus (100) has a CPU (101) which controls the overall apparatus, a memory (103) which stores various programs, a memory (104) which stores various data, an HMD (105) as a video display device, and a position and orientation controller (106) having position and orientation sensors (107, 108, 109), which are connected to each other via a bus (102). After a position and orientation required to render a CG scene for one frame are determined, when CG objects are in an interference state immediately before this processing and the difference between the current time and an interference time (128) set upon determining the interference state does not exceed an interference detection skip time (124), CG image generation means (112) generates a CG scene for one frame based on the determined position and orientation without checking if an interference has occurred between the CG objects.
